Soft drink consumers at a higher risk of cancer

New York: People who consume one or more cans of cold drinks per day are exposing themselves to a potential carcinogen, warns a new study.

The ingredient, 4-methylimidazole (4-MEI) - a possible human carcinogen - is formed during the manufacture of some kinds of caramel colour. Caramel colour is a common ingredient in colas and other dark soft drinks.
